I doubt that any of us are in a position to say conclusively one way or the other whether the effect claimed by Audioquest is likely to be great enough in degree to be audibly significant in some or many systems. But let's assume that it is. The explanation revolves around electrical noise. Sensitivity to electrical noise that may be present will be highly dependent on the specific designs of the components, cables, and system that are involved, on how AC power is distributed to the various components, on how the components and cables are physically arranged, and on the noise environment at the particular location. And it will be highly dependent on the spectral composition (frequency distribution) as well as the amplitudes of whatever noise may be present.
As I said in one of my previous posts in this thread, noise effects tend to have little if any predictability, and tend to be highly system and even location dependent.
It should be noted, finally, that none of these factors have any particular correlation with the sonic quality or musical resolution of the system, or with the hearing acuity of the particular listener.
